Understanding the Innovation

Linkup is a French startup creating an API that connects developers with web content from trusted sources. This allows AI models to provide more accurate and relevant answers by using real-time information. The method, known as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G), aims to improve the quality of AI-generated responses while addressing the growing concerns around content scraping and copyright issues. As AI continues to evolve, the demand for reliable data sources is critical.

Key Details

  • Linkup offers a marketplace that connects content publishers with AI developers, ensuring proper licensing for content use.
  • The startup pays publishers based on how often their content is accessed, promoting fair compensation.
  • Linkup integrates with publishers’ content management systems (CMS) to fetch data without scraping.
  • The company has raised €3 million in seed funding and plans to expand its team, focusing initially on corporate and business information.
